The Digital Shift in Art Acquisition
The digital age has actually substantially altered how individuals communicate with art and antiques. Online public auctions and digital exhibitions are no more novelties; they are essential to the modern enthusiast's journey. Online experiences now use a seamless method for buyers to check out collections from around the world without leaving their homes.
This shift additionally implies that fine art appraisals are ending up being much more data-driven. With accessibility to digital cataloging, provenance documentation, and AI-enhanced evaluation, appraisers are currently geared up with devices that provide better accuracy and openness. This empowers both customers and vendors to make confident, enlightened decisions, also in online setups.

The Rising Influence of Asian Art
Global rate of interest in Asian art remains to skyrocket. Whether it's typical ink paints, porcelains, jade sculptures, or modern jobs by arising Asian musicians, enthusiasts are identifying the splendor and social value of these items. This fad has actually triggered better need for Asian art appraisers, professionals who bring not only know-how yet additionally social level of sensitivity to their evaluations.
Their role is important in browsing complicated provenance and recognizing the detailed symbolism typically present in Asian pieces. As the global appetite for Asian art expands, so also does the demand for deep expertise and accuracy in its evaluation.
Innovation's Role in Authenticity and Security
In a market where authenticity is paramount, technology is stepping up to home plate. Blockchain is being made use of to produce tamper-proof records of provenance, while high-resolution imaging and spectroscopy devices aid find bogus. These developments guarantee that the work of art appraisers stays trustworthy and reliable, especially when managing high-value deals.
Additionally, these innovations are altering how items are insured, saved, and transferred. The traditional art market's dependence on paper-based systems is quickly being changed with protected electronic protocols, developing smoother and much more safe and secure processes for enthusiasts and organizations alike.

The Hybrid Model of Auctions
Physical auction gallery occasions are not going anywhere, yet they're being boosted by electronic devices. Crossbreed public auctions-- which incorporate in-person and online bidding process-- are becoming the standard. This method not only enhances ease of access however likewise broadens the purchaser base, bringing in worldwide rate of interest and younger tech-savvy participants.
This crossbreed version additionally affects prices patterns and bidding behaviors. The convenience of online bidding process and real-time analytics enables auction houses to plan with higher precision.
